随着信息技术的飞速发展,网络工程师的角色变得愈发重要。为了培养和选拔优秀的网络工程师,国家设立了网络工程师考试。这一考试旨在评估考生在计算机网络领域的专业知识和技能。下面,我们就来详细了解一下国家网络工程师考试的内容。

一、网络基础知识

网络基础知识是网络工程师考试的核心内容之一。这包括网络拓扑结构、协议、路由、交换、传输等基础概念。考生需要熟练掌握OSI七层模型、TCP/IP协议族以及各类网络设备的工作原理。此外,对于网络架构的设计和规划也是考试的重点,考生需要具备设计稳定、高效的网络架构的能力。

二、网络安全技术

在网络安全日益受到重视的今天,网络安全技术也成为了网络工程师考试不可或缺的一部分。这部分内容主要包括网络攻击与防御、数据加密与解密、身份认证与授权、网络安全策略等。考生需要了解常见的网络攻击手段,如DDoS攻击、SQL注入等,并掌握相应的防御措施。同时,对于数据加密技术,如AES、RSA等加密算法,考生也需要有深入的了解。

三、系统管理

系统管理是网络工程师日常工作中不可或缺的一部分。在考试中,这部分内容主要包括操作系统安装与配置、网络设备管理、系统监控与维护、备份与恢复等。考生需要熟悉各类操作系统的安装与配置方法,以及如何通过网络设备进行管理。此外,对于系统的监控和维护,考生也需要掌握相应的工具和技术,以确保系统的稳定运行。

四、数据库管理

数据库管理是网络工程师考试中另一重要内容。这包括数据库设计、SQL语言、数据库管理以及数据备份与恢复等方面。考生需要掌握数据库设计的基本原则和方法,熟练使用SQL语言进行数据的查询、插入、更新和删除操作。同时,对于数据库的性能优化和故障排除,考生也需要有一定的了解和实践经验。

五、软件开发与项目管理

虽然网络工程师的主要工作集中在网络领域,但软件开发和项目管理知识也是考试中不可忽视的一部分。考生需要了解基本的编程语言和开发工具,如Java、Python等,并熟悉软件开发的流程和项目管理方法。这有助于网络工程师在实际工作中更好地与软件开发团队进行协作和沟通。

综上所述,国家网络工程师考试内容涵盖了网络基础知识、网络安全技术、系统管理、数据库管理以及软件开发与项目管理等多个方面。为了顺利通过考试,考生需要全面掌握这些知识和技能,并注重实践经验的积累。同时,不断关注行业动态和技术发展趋势,也是成为一名优秀网络工程师的必备素质。希望广大考生能够认真备考,以最佳状态迎接国家网络工程师考试的挑战!